May 25, 2017 We often listen to the terms power cleaning and pressure washing being used mutually. It might appear a bit confusing, but we're right here to help clear points up, when and for all. The basic feature is the very same: they both make use of very pressurized water to help remove dirt and other materials from hard surfaces.
Essentially, power cleaning is the much more sturdy choice. Stress washing is what you've probably used at your home before. It makes use of the very same high-pressure water blast as power cleaning but doesn't make use of warmed water. This normal temperature water still does an outstanding work at blasting away dust however doesn't perform as well against moss, mold, or various other difficult stuck on materials.

Currently that you understand the major distinctions between power cleaning and pressure washing, it's time to figure which one you require for your home. For routine home use, stress washing is the means to go.For any kind of bigger tasks, like a huge business area or an added large driveway and patio area, opt for power cleaning. The heated water generally assists to make the work go quicker since the warmth assists to loosen up the dirt. For that very same reason, though, you have to be mindful which surfaces you utilize it on.

And the expenses for power washing are usually billed on a per-square-foot basis, varying from $0.30 - $0.80 per square foot to cleanse your home. These systems are usually gas powered and make use of really warm water or vapor. Below's a checklist of some power washing solutions and the typical expenses for each: Spray out rain gutters: $50 - $150 Get rid of mold and mold from vinyl-sided homes: $170 - $360 Tidy up pavers or concrete: $100 - $270 Eliminate moss from roof covering: $250 - $600 Tidy up decks and patio areas: $120 - $250 Laundry down fencing: $150 - $300 If they're linking to your water supply through a yard tube, you can expect them to spray out concerning 10 - 15 gallons of water per min.
